Transaction 05612cf9ad8bbf8c76002e1a6ab138ec36445249e1a822f09cd5aa20523e958e

17 Input
2 Outputs
  • 05612cf9ad8bbf8c76002e1a6ab138ec36445249e1a822f09cd5aa20523e958e:0
  • value  10000000
    address  1KfvxQdaqkMTd3BHsCbPN1q5cw7wHVvoE2
  • 05612cf9ad8bbf8c76002e1a6ab138ec36445249e1a822f09cd5aa20523e958e:1
  • value  698821
    address  38WVmmHi2NsSQzGQn2QPQn5qxh7zvty5tn